Immerse yourself in the timeless elegance of Joseph Haydn's symphonic mastery with "HAYDNDYAH," a captivating collection of three of his most renowned symphonies. Released on September 20, 2024, by Berlin Classics, this album features the brilliant Concerto Copenhagen ensemble, conducted by the esteemed Lars Ulrik Mortensen. The album spans a total of 12 tracks, encapsulating the essence of Haydn's genius in a little over an hour.
The album opens with Symphony No. 43 in E-Flat Major, "Mercury," a work that showcases Haydn's ability to blend clarity and complexity. The second symphony, No. 44 in E Minor, "Mourning," is a poignant exploration of grief and reflection, highlighted by its hauntingly beautiful Adagio movement. The album concludes with Symphony No. 47 in G Major, "Palindrome," a symphony known for its unique structural ingenuity, where the first and last movements are mirror images of each other.

Franz Joseph Haydn, a titan of the Classical period, stands as one of the most influential composers in Western music history. Born in Rohrau, Austria, in 1732, Haydn's prolific output and innovative spirit earned him the titles "Father of the Symphony" and "Father of the String Quartet." His genius lies in his ability to synthesize emerging musical styles, creating a balanced fusion of intellect and emotion that resonates with audiences to this day. Haydn's contributions to chamber music, particularly the string quartet and piano trio, have left an indelible mark on the genre.
